- 博客(7)
- 资源 (3)
- 收藏
- 关注
原创 Android 设计模式 之 观察者模式
/* * 观察者模式 * 定义对象间的一种一个(Subject)对多(Observer)的依赖关系,当一个对象的状态发送改变时,所以依赖于它的 * 对象都得到通知并被自动更新 * * 当然,MVC只是Observer模式的一个实例。Observer模式要解决的问题为: * 建立一个一(Subject)对多(Observer)的依赖关系,并且做到当“一”变化的时候, * 依赖这个
2012-07-23 11:19:11 30147 3
原创 Android 设计模式 之 单例模式
1、单例模式常见情景设计模式中,最简单不过的就是单例模式。先看看单例模式原文:http://www.iteye.com/topic/575052Singleton模式可以是很简单的,它的全部只需要一个类就可以完成(看看这章可怜的UML图)。但是如果在“对象创建的次数以及何时被创建”这两点上较真起来,Singleton模式可以相当的复杂,比头五种模式加起来还复杂,譬如涉及到DCL
2012-07-10 21:38:33 6205 2
原创 Linux 驱动学习笔记3 -- 字符设备驱动实例(driver+client)
字符设备驱动实例有了上一节的基础,下面学习一下如何编写一个字符设备驱动,并通过客户端测试,验证字符设备驱动是否创建成功1、字符设备驱动程序下面是字符设备驱动源码borytest.c#include #include #include #include #include #include #include #include #include
2012-07-10 17:31:34 1908 1
原创 Linux 驱动学习笔记2 -- Timer
Linux内核定时器一、定义/include/linux/timer.hstruct timer_list {struct list_head entry;unsigned long expires;void (*function)(unsigned long);unsigned long data;struct tvec_t_base_s *base;#ifdef
2012-07-10 16:21:35 2788
原创 Linux 驱动学习笔记1 -- HelloWorld
想学习一下驱动,于是找了一个实例HelloWorld,编写自己的第一个驱动程序1、环境搭建安装ubuntu系统,打开终端,以root权限进入,命令如下bory@borya:~$ sudo -s查看自己linux内核包root@borya:~# apt-cache search linux-sourcelinux-source - Linux ker
2012-07-09 22:11:12 1661 2
转载 Android 远程图片缓存
那么如何处理好图片资源的获取和管理呢?异步下载本地缓存异步下载大家都知道,在android应用中UI线程5秒没响应的话就会抛出无响应异常,对于远程获取大的资源来说,这种异常还是很容易就会抛出来的,那么怎么避免这种问题的产生。在android中提供两种方法来做这件事情:启动一个新的线程来获取资源,完成后通过Handler机制发送消息,并在UI线程中处理消息,从而达到在异步线程中获
2012-07-03 22:19:53 687
转载 android json解析及简单例子
JSON的定义:一种轻量级的数据交换格式,具有良好的可读和便于快速编写的特性。业内主流技术为其提供了完整的解决方案(有点类似于正则表达式 ,获得了当今大部分语言的支持),从而可以在不同平台间进行数据交换。JSON采用兼容性很高的文本格式,同时也具备类似于C语言体系的行为。 – Json.orgJSON Vs XML1.JSON和XML的数据可读性基本相同2.JS
2012-07-03 21:58:31 1060
Android Socket通信(实现手机控制电脑)
2012-05-21
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人